Index of /media/image/39/e1/66
Name
Last modified
Size
Description
Parent Directory
-
1627637563_868803499371_1280x1280@2x.jpg
2022-10-31 14:53
18K
102055WuhG5u4op2Uaw_600x600.jpg
2022-10-31 14:53
55K
Apache Server at u323264.your-storagebox.de Port 443